首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

提交数据时未出现警告框

是指在数据提交过程中,没有弹出任何警告框或提示框来提醒用户可能存在的错误或异常情况。这可能是由于以下几种情况导致的:

  1. 前端验证不完善:前端开发中,通常会对用户输入的数据进行一些基本的验证,例如检查是否为空、格式是否正确等。如果前端验证不完善或者没有进行验证,那么即使用户输入了错误的数据,也不会触发警告框的显示。
  2. 后端验证缺失:即使前端验证通过,后端开发也应该对数据进行进一步的验证和处理,以确保数据的完整性和安全性。如果后端验证缺失或者没有进行验证,那么即使数据存在问题,也不会触发警告框的显示。
  3. 异步提交:在某些情况下,数据的提交可能是通过异步方式进行的,例如使用Ajax技术。在这种情况下,数据的提交过程是在后台进行的,不会中断用户的操作并弹出警告框。
  4. 浏览器设置:有些浏览器可能会屏蔽弹出窗口或警告框,以提高用户体验或防止恶意弹窗。如果用户的浏览器设置了屏蔽弹窗,那么即使代码中存在弹出警告框的逻辑,也不会显示出来。

针对提交数据时未出现警告框的情况,可以采取以下措施来解决:

  1. 前端验证:在前端开发中,应该对用户输入的数据进行全面的验证,包括必填项、格式验证、长度限制等。可以使用HTML5的表单验证功能或JavaScript框架如jQuery Validation等来实现。
  2. 后端验证:在后端开发中,对接收到的数据进行验证和处理,确保数据的完整性和安全性。可以使用服务器端的验证框架或自定义验证逻辑来实现。
  3. 错误处理:在数据提交过程中,如果发现数据存在问题,应该及时给出错误提示,可以通过在页面上显示错误信息、弹出提示框或者将错误信息返回给前端进行展示。
  4. 浏览器兼容性:在开发过程中,应该考虑不同浏览器的兼容性,确保代码在各种主流浏览器上都能正常运行,并且能够弹出警告框。

总结起来,提交数据时未出现警告框可能是由于前端验证不完善、后端验证缺失、异步提交或浏览器设置等原因导致的。为了解决这个问题,需要在前端和后端都进行全面的数据验证和处理,并确保代码在各种浏览器上都能正常运行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券